Switzerland: a new defeat for the C-295Ms

Berne, Switzerland - The aircraft would not be considered as a strictly necessary one, according to those who vote against it in the National Council

Nothing to do for the purchase of two EADS-CASA C-295M military airlifters in Switzerland (see for details AVIONEWS). National Council defeated the initiative maintaining that no plausible reasons would exist to afford such an expense.
